We wrap our salute to John Perry Barlow with one of the most stunning pairings in the Dead repertoire, "Lost Sailor" and "Saint of Circumstance," with "Sailor" coming from Radio City Music Hall in 1980 and "Saint" from Giants Stadium in 1991.
